  Q45 Won't Turn/Start


Here's a little background...one day the q wouldn't start. after checking the battery, ignition fuse, ignition releay, starter relay, anti-theft and starter, it was determined to be the starter solenoid (tap on the starter solenoid and voila).

so one day i started the car with the remote start, i had to tap on the on the starter solenoid btw. the car ran for about 10-15 seconds and i opened the trunk. alarm went off and the car turned off. i tried to start it with the key and it was sluggish as if the battery was dead. so i charged the battery and tried to start it with the key the next day...nothing but clicks.

i tap on the starter solenoid still nothing but clicks. so i remove the starter, take it to autozone they test it twice and the computer says that it is fine.

i put the starter back in, try to start with the key, nothing but clicks. i feel the solenoid to see it the plunger is popping out and it is.

what could be the cause? does starting the car for 10-15 seconds and shutting it off have a negative effect? at this point i am ready to just replace the starter just to rule that out.

Obviously you have not kept up with the numerous reports of recent examples of Optima problems and short life- seems their quality took a dump within the last couple years.

The Optima is NOT a gel cell battery, but an Absorbed Glass Mat {AGM} design.

12.1 volts is a seriously DISCHARGED battery, as a fully charged AGM battery reads 12.9-13.1 volts- without a proper LOAD TEST performed on the battery, one can never know if it has the CURRENT to properly spin the starter.

Look. You can jump to conclusions or do the free, simple tests first. We already know the solenoid is on its way out since you have had to smack it in the past, so just try the headlight test. Takes literally ten seconds with a buddy to watch the lights or parked at night with the headlights pointed toward some object as to make it easy to see whether or not they dim. I would begin to be concerned about the battery if the accessories and other major electrical components did not function. Just use common sense. If the headlights are dim in the first place its a battery issure, if everything works and the headlights don't dim upon crankage then you know it's a starter/solenoid issue as it won't draw power from the functioning battery.
